Diana Childrens Community Service - Paediatric Respiratory Physiotherapists
Our Diana paediatric respiratory physiotherapists assess and treat children with complex disabilities with additional respiratory issues in the community.
We train families, carers and schools in chest physiotherapy to try to reduce hospital admissions caused by chest infections. We complete rapid response visits to children when they are acutely unwell. Additionally, we provide an in-reach service onto the childrens wards of UHL, so that we can closely monitor if any children known to us have been admitted, aiming to assist in a more rapid discharge from hospital where appropriate.
Two community paediatric respiratory physiotherapists are developing this service which is delivered from homes, schools, providers of respite care, acute wards and nurseries.

Referral criteria
Children and young people up to 18 years old who have complex disabilities with additional respiratory issues.
